Reconstruction of abandoned bridge excites Kwara monarch
The Olomu of Omu-Aran, Oba Abdulraheem Adeoti, on Saturday, commended the lawmaker reconstructing abandoned Ologoro bridge, linking GRA with David Bamigboye’s way in Omu-Aran, Irepodun Local Government Area of Kwara.
Adeoti, who visited the site of the on-going reconstruction, hailed Rep. Tunji Ajuloopin for his foresight and commitment to communal service.
The Newsmen reports that the project is personally funded by Ajuloopin, representing Ekiti/Isin/Irepodun/Oke-Ero Federal Constituency of Kwara.
The monarch said the bridge would ease the smooth flow of traffic not only for motorists and commercial motorcyclists but for other road users when completed.
”It will help road users especially, pedestrians and traders in carrying out their commercial and business activities,” Adeoti said.
